What is Dysautonomia?
Think of your Autonomic Nervous System (ANS) as the "autopilot" of your body. It controls everything you don’t have to think about: your breathing, digestion, temperature, and—most importantly—your heart rate and blood pressure.
Dysautonomia is simply an umbrella term. It means the autopilot isn't working correctly. Instead of smooth adjustments, the system overreacts or underreacts to daily life.
What is POTS?
POTS (Postural Orthostatic Tachycardia Syndrome) is a specific type of Dysautonomia.
In a healthy body, when you stand up, gravity pulls your blood downward. Your nervous system instantly tells your blood vessels to tighten and your heart to beat slightly faster to keep blood flowing to your brain.
If you have POTS, that communication bridge is broken. When you stand, your body panics. To compensate for the lack of blood reaching the top of your body, your heart starts racing (tachycardia) to make up for it.
Why One Leads to the Other
The link is simple: Dysautonomia is the cause, and POTS is the symptom.
If Dysautonomia is the "glitch" in the software of your nervous system, POTS is one way that glitch shows up physically. Here is why they are often discussed together:
Communication Breakdown: The brain isn't receiving the right signals from the body about where the blood is pooling.
Adrenaline Spikes: Because the body feels "unstable" when upright, it may dump adrenaline into your system, causing shakiness and anxiety.
The "Invisible" Struggle: Because the issue is about function (how things work) rather than structure (how things look), many patients have the "dysautonomia link" overlooked for years.
